Small
or start-up businesses located in Howard County, Maryland
are invited to apply for loans through j-ref in amounts ranging
from $5,000 to $100,000 in order to meet expansion or start-up
costs. The maximum
loan term is seven years. The program is open to businesses
unable to receive financing from traditional sources.
Eligibility Businesses eligible for j-ref assistance must meet the following basic criteria before being considered:
- The
business must be located in Howard County.
- The
business must be a for-profit venture.
- The
business must be a full-time endeavor.
Requirements In addition to eligibility, businesses are required to submit and maintain the following required j-ref materials: - Borrowers must submit a written business plan and a completed j-ref application.
- Borrowers must have all necessary permits and licenses to conduct a legal business.
- Applicants must sign the j-ref Release and Indemnification Form.
- All applicants must maintain adequate financial statements and supply j-ref with quarterly financial reports.
- Personal guarantees of all business owners will be required.
- Names of all owners, controlling principals and managers must be disclosed.
- A satisfactory credit history will be required. A current (90 days) credit report must be submitted.
j-ref loans are for business purposes only. Proceeds of loans made by j-ref may not be used to repay any debt, to purchase real estate, or to pay for travel expenses. Personal assets will be taken as collateral if business assets are not sufficient to secure the loan. All applicants' past performance and management abilities will be reviewed prior to funding. The program is open to all applicants regardless of race, sex, or national origin. Any loan directly or indirectly benefiting an officer, a participating financial institution, an elected official of Howard County, or the immediate family of such officers and officials is prohibited Business Plan Requirements All of the following information must be submitted as part of the business plan prior to funding consideration. - Proforma business plan indicating revenues, assumptions, expenses, profit/loss, and cash flow projections for the next three years.
- Staffing plan including proposed positions, salary ranges, number of positions and expected or approximate hiring dates.
- Historic balance sheet and income statement for the business (existing businesses).
- Personal financial statements for all owners.
- Tax returns (personal, business) for the last two years.
- Proposed collateral to support the loan.
- Current personal credit report (not more than 90 days old ).
- Release and Indemnification signed.
- Resume for all owners, principals and managers.
Fees The j-ref application fee is the greater of: one-half of one percent (.5%) of the requested loan amount; or $350, payable to j-ref. j-ref also requires a one-time, non-refundable loan origination fee of 1.0% of the requested loan amount due at closing.
